Q: Divorce within 7 months of registry marriage

I have registered my marriage in the month of may this year. But we are not sociaaly maaried yet. Now I dont want to stay with the person anymore. How can I free myself from this marriage? If my spouse is ready for it then can we file divorce before 1 year of marriage?

Advocate Rajdeep Pradhan answered
Yes you can prefer for mutual divorce after 6 months of your marriage. Court marriage is valid and you are eligible to file mutual divorce now.



Q: Husband not showing up for hearing of mutual divorce

Divorce - Petitioner(husband) not showing up on hearing(2nd hearing) date after placing a mutual divorce petition. Please advice what could be done to get it resolved?

Advocate Rajdeep Pradhan answered
Both the parties has to appear on all dates otherwise the mutual petition will be dismissed by the Court. When such situation arises where one of the parties remain absent, it will to be deemed as divorce by contest and hence, the mutual petition shall be dismissed.



Q: I have purchased land in 2001 and someone is claiming a part of it

I have purchased in the year 2001 by 2 parties 24 decimal of land total of 48 decimal. I have done online registration 7-12 in the year 2014 for both piece of land. Now someone is claiming that his father gifted him 9 decimal of land from my purchased land in the year 1996. He has done 7-12 registration in the year 2009. I am paying land tax since 2001 for entire 48 decimal. I have got gharbari registration for land. Now how to justify this case as I guess its a conspiracy to create dispute and get some money out of it.  Can demarcation help me in this case

Advocate Rajdeep Pradhan answered
If your name is recorded in the ROR and Sale deed has been made in your favour, then it is his burden to prove his case and file suit for declaring your ROR and Sale Deed null and void. Hence, do not need to panic, and keep eyes on what steps do he take. If he files any such suit, then hire an advocate and take legal steps such as move petition for adding necessary party and thereafter file written statement, etc.



Q: Uncle threatening to take all the properties of grandfather

Hi.. My Grandparents have some house properties & fixed deposits of their own. Now they are very old & could not operate. But one of my uncle(grandparents middle son) is threatened us to take all the properties & told to bit me. Give me a proper solution.

Advocate Rajdeep Pradhan answered
This is all rubbish because he cannot do anything. After grandparents death, the property shall be divided by virtue of partition suit and so far as the movable properties are concerned (savings, fixed deposits, etc), it shall be divided as per the number of legal heirs jointly in case where there is no nominee.
